# ChipGate Reader — Limits & Quotas

The Fennwick ChipGate mats at the Oakbarrow Marathon cap reads per antenna pass. Past 1,200 tags/sec the dedup buffer overflows and splits get dropped silently. Do not raise antenna gain to compensate; it causes cross-mat ghost reads. Backhaul uplink is rate-limited; bursts queue locally for up to 90 seconds. If the queue alarm fires, check these constants first:

tuning table, faduf-baduf:
PRIORITIES = {
    "ulavan": 191,
    "silys": 750,
    "goriel": 238,
    "kelmir": 66,
    "wendor": 432,
}

The Checkrow plugin system began rejecting validator uploads at 03:10 because the registry service credential expired. All third-party data validators that refresh their manifests are failing with auth errors; cached manifests still load, so ingest is degraded but not down. Rotation was supposed to be automated, but the renewal job was disabled during last month's migration. A replacement key has been issued and verified against staging. For the on-call remediation, apply the key below to the registry config.

service key, fawip-bajef: kto11_Qt5wZK9vdNC

Quarterly Planning Note — Divestiture of the Coastal Tooling Unit

For the finance team: the sale of the Coastal Tooling unit to Pellmark Industries remains on track for close in Q3. Please finalize the carve-out balance sheet, reconcile intercompany positions, and prepare the working-capital adjustment schedule by month-end. Audit support requests should be prioritized. For planning purposes, note the following sensitive item:

internal memo for hawef-kahif: The finance team signed off on a budget of $25.9 million for Project Sorox. The renewal with Pelokek Logistics closes at $51.7 million a year, 52 percent below the last contract.

Subject: Key rotation for InvoiceForge renderer

Welcome, new folks. Every quarter we rotate the credential the Pellworth PDF invoice renderer uses to call our internal asset service, Vaultline. The old key stops working Friday at noon. Update your local .env and the staging config before then, and verify a test invoice renders with the new embedded fonts. For convenience, the freshly issued key is included here.

app token of bagef-bageg = kto11_vuwA0uhrEMg